How much do production associate first j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for production associate first in Grand Prairie, TX is $15.93,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.65 and $17.31 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Production Associate First vs Production Associate Second?

AspectProduction Associate FirstProduction Associate Second
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may prefer experience
Work EnvironmentManufacturing or production floor, fast-pacedSimilar environment, often with increased responsibilities
Employer UsageEntry-level position in manufacturingNext step in production roles, requiring more experience

The main difference between Production Associate First and Production Associate Second lies in experience and responsibilities. Production Associate Second typically has more on-the-job experience and may handle additional tasks or supervise certain processes. Both roles share similar credentials and work environments, but the second level often involves increased duties and skill requirements.

What are entry-level production associate jobs?

Entry-level production associate jobs involve performing basic tasks in manufacturing or production environments, such as assembling products, operating machinery, and maintaining cleanliness. These roles typically require little prior experience and may involve working in shifts, with opportunities to learn skills like quality control and safety procedures.

What is an entry-level production associate?

An entry-level production associate is a worker who performs basic tasks in a manufacturing or production environment, often requiring minimal prior experience. They typically handle tasks such as assembling products, operating machinery, and maintaining safety standards, with opportunities to learn on the job and develop skills for advancement.

What should a production associate do?

A production associate is responsible for assisting in the manufacturing process by operating machinery, assembling products, and ensuring quality standards are met. They typically follow safety protocols, work in a team environment, and may need to use tools or equipment specific to the production line.

About the Alltech Family of Companies:
Made up of over 20 companies and dozens of brands around the world, the Alltech Family of Companies is aligning to provide smarter, more sustainable solutions for global nourishment.
Ridley Block Operations, an Alltech company, manufactures and markets block supplements, loose minerals, and dried molasses. Products are sold under highly recognized and proprietary brand names, including CRYSTALYXยฎ, SWEETLIXยฎ, ULTRALYXยฎ and STOCKADEยฎ Brands, in addition to a number of controlled and private labels.
